## Understanding Cloud Services

Before delving into costs, it’s essential to comprehend what cloud services entail. At its core, cloud computing delivers hosted services over the internet, which can range from infrastructure, platforms, and software that are governed by various pricing models. 

### Types of Cloud Services

1. **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S)**: This model provides virtualized computing resources over the internet. Examples include AWS and Microsoft Azure.

2. **Platform as a Service (PaaS)**: PaaS offers hardware and software tools over the internet, usually for application development. This model streamlines the development process.

3. **Software as a Service (SaaS)**: SaaS delivers software applications via the internet on a subscription basis. Examples include Google Workspace and Salesforce.

Each model comes with its pricing structure, which may include pay-as-you-go, subscription-based, or usage-based pricing.

## Key Factors Influencing Cloud Service Costs

The overall costs of HQ cloud services can vary greatly due to several factors:

### 1. Usage Volume

The more you use the cloud services, the higher the costs could be. For example, APIs are often charged based on the number of requests made. If an organization heavily relies on APIs, it could incur substantial costs.

### 2. Type of Services

Different cloud services come with different price tags. For instance, IaaS tends to charge based on the amount of virtual resources consumed, whereas SaaS solutions usually operate on a per-user subscription fee.

### 3. API Calls

APIs play a crucial role in cloud services. Costs can accrue based on the number of API calls made. Some services charge per request, while others offer packages based on a defined number of calls. The choice of API gateway can significantly impact costs, as choosing an efficient and well-managed one can optimize expenditure.

### 4. Geographic Location

Cloud service pricing can also vary by geographical region. Services in high-demand regions may be more expensive due to increased demand and operational costs.

### 5. Vendor and Pricing Policy

Different cloud vendors have varying pricing strategies. Some may provide extensive free tiers, while others might charge higher prices without a free tier.

## Pricing Models of Cloud Services

Cost structures in the cloud can often be convoluted. Below are the primary pricing models:

| **Pricing Model**         | **Description**                                                          | **Typical Use Cases**                           |
|---------------------------|--------------------------------------------------------------------------|------------------------------------------------|
| **Pay-as-you-go**         | Charges based on actual usage.                                          | Web hosting, API services                       |
| **Subscription**          | Monthly or annual fees for access to the service.                       | Software applications, streaming services       |
| **Reserved Instances**    | Upfront payment for a set period of resource capacity.                  | Long-term projects requiring consistent capacity |
| **Freemium**              | Basic services are free; premium features incur charges.                | SaaS applications, basic online services        |

### Evaluating Costs with APIs

When integrating with APIs, consider the following cost evaluation metrics:

1. **Request Volume**: Track the number of API requests meticulously, as these can accumulate costs quickly.

2. **Rate Limiting**: Review limits imposed on API calls to avoid unexpected charges.

3. **Performance Metrics**: Some services charge based on performance requirements, including speed and reliability.

4. **Data Transfer Costs**: Be wary of data transfer fees that can also add to the expenses.

### OpenAPI Benefits

OpenAPI offers a standard way to define and document REST APIs. By using OpenAPI specifications, organizations can streamline development and reduce costs associated with API integration. The benefits of adopting OpenAPI include easier collaboration among developers, automated documentation processes, and reduced chances of breaking changes during API updates, thus lowering potential support costs.

## Hidden Costs in Cloud Services

While calculating cloud service expenses, organizations often overlook hidden costs. Here are key areas to consider:

### 1. Data Transfer Fees

Sending data to and from the cloud incurs costs that can be significant, depending on the bandwidth requirements and frequency of transfers.

### 2. API Call Overage Charges

Many contracts include limits on the number of API calls allowed within a given period. Exceeding these limits can lead to large overage charges.

### 3. Storage Costs

Additional storage for data, logs, and backups can contribute significantly to cloud expenses. Review the costs associated with various storage classes or options.

### 4. Support and Maintenance

Premium support services come at a cost. While some vendors offer basic support for free, advanced support services will incur fees that need to be factored in.
